Gas furnace rep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ues that affect the proper operation of a gas-powered heating system. Technicians assess components such as the burners, heat exchangers, thermostats, and ignition systems to identify malfunctions or wear that may hinder performance. Repairs can include replacing faulty parts, cleaning or adjusting burners, fixing electrical connections, or addressing ventilation problems. The goal is to restore the furnace’s efficiency and ensure it heats a property safely and reliably.
These services help resolve common problems like inconsistent heating, strange noises, frequent cycling, or failure to turn on. A malfunctioning gas furnace can lead to uneven temperatures, increased energy bills, or safety concerns related to gas leaks or improper venting.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ent further damage to the system and maintain a comfortable indoor environment. Repair Costs - The typical cost for gas furnace repairs ranges from $150 to $600, depending on the issue. Minor repairs like thermostat replacements tend to be on the lower end, while major component fixes can reach higher amounts.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for gas furnace repair services usually fall between $75 and $150 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the complexity of the repair and the local service provider’s rates.
Parts and Components - Replacement parts such as igniters, thermostats, or motors generally cost between $50 and $300. The overall repair cost increases with the number and type of parts needed.
Service Call Fees - Service call fees for gas furnace repairs often range from $50 to $100, which may be included in the total repair cost. These fees cover the technician’s visit and initial assessment of the issue.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a gas furnace needs repair? Indicators include uneven heating, strange noises, increased energy bills, or the furnace not turning on at all. If these signs are noticed, contacting a local service provider is recommended.
How long does gas furnace repair typically take? Repair times can vary depending on the issue, but most common repairs are completed within a few hours by experienced technicians.
Are there preventive measures to reduce the likelihood of furnace breakdowns? Regular maintenance, such as filter changes and system inspections, can help prevent unexpected issues and extend the lifespan of a gas furnace.
What should I do if my gas furnace is emitting strange odors? If unusual smells are detected, it is advisable to contact a professional promptly to inspect the system and ensure safety.
Can a damaged gas furnace be repaired or does it need replacement? Many issues are repairable by a qualified technician, but in cases of extensive damage or age, replacement may be recommended by local service providers.
